ITIN for Amazon FBM Sellers: What Tax ID Do You Need?
What Tax ID Does Amazon Actually Require From FBM Sellers?
Amazon Seller Central runs a mandatory tax interview before any seller can list products. The interview routes the seller to one of three forms based on tax status:
- Form W-9: US persons (US citizens, green card holders, resident aliens, and US LLCs). Requires SSN, ITIN, or EIN.
- Form W-8BEN: Foreign individuals. Requires foreign tax ID; US TIN (ITIN) is needed to claim treaty benefits and avoid 30% withholding.
- Form W-8BEN-E: Foreign entities. Requires foreign tax ID or US EIN. Treaty benefits require the foreign entity to have a tax residence in a treaty country.
FBM and FBA both require the same interview; the fulfillment model does not change the TIN requirement.
When Does a Foreign FBM Seller Use an ITIN vs an EIN?
A foreign individual selling under their own name uses an ITIN on Form W-8BEN. A foreign individual selling through a US LLC (single-member or multi-member) uses the LLC's EIN on Form W-9. The owner of the LLC still typically needs an ITIN for their personal Form 1040 or 1040-NR.
Most growing FBM sellers eventually convert to the LLC + EIN structure: liability protection, US business bank account, easier access to wholesale suppliers, and cleaner sales tax compliance.
How Does a Foreign Amazon FBM Seller Apply for an ITIN?
- Complete Form W-7on the October 2024 revision or later. Most sellers use line 6 code "a" (non-resident filing a US tax return).
- Attach Form 1040-NR reporting US-source business income, or claim a documented IRS exception.
- Provide foreign passport (cleanest single document) or two documents from the IRS list.
- Submit through a Certifying Acceptance Agent so the passport is verified locally and never mailed to the IRS.

What Happens If an FBM Seller Has No US TIN at All?
Without a US TIN, Amazon classifies the seller as an undocumented foreign person and applies 30% withholding on US- source income. The seller still owes US tax, has no easy way to reclaim withholding without a TIN, and may have the Seller Central account suspended for failed tax interview compliance.
The fix is straightforward: file Form W-7 for an ITIN (or apply for an EIN for the LLC) before the next major payout period.
What Tax Returns Does an Amazon FBM Seller File With an ITIN?
- Form 1040-NR (foreign individual): reports US- source business income from Amazon FBM sales.
- Form 1040 + Schedule C (US resident alien): full self-employment reporting when the substantial presence test is met.
- Form 1120 + 5472 (foreign-owned LLC, single-member, disregarded): required information return regardless of income level.
- State income tax returns: depend on physical presence and inventory nexus.
How Long Until the ITIN Is Ready to Use on Amazon?
Standard IRS processing is 7 to 11 weeks. Once the ITIN assignment letter (CP565) arrives, the seller updates the Amazon tax interview by entering the new ITIN on Form W-8BEN. Amazon validates the TIN within a few days; backup withholding stops on the next payment cycle.
